The Fujitsu iRMC S4 (integrated Remote Management Controller) is the fourth generation of Fujitsu's powerful Baseboard Management Controller (BMC) technology, which is integrated into PRIMERGY servers. It is an autonomous system on the server's motherboard, complete with its own operating system, web server, user management, and alert management. This independent operation allows the iRMC S4 to remain powered and active even when the main server is in standby mode, providing truly capabilities. In essence, it acts as a "mini-server" within your server, enabling full control regardless of the server's primary OS state. fujitsu irmc s4 license key full

To understand the value of the license key, one must first understand the limitations of the "default" state. Out of the box, the iRMC S4 system provides standard instrumentation compliant with IPMI (Intelligent Platform Management Interface). This allows administrators to monitor hardware sensors—such as fan speeds, temperature, and power supply status—and receive alerts if systems overheat or fail. While useful, this level of access is passive. It does not allow for active intervention or complex remote control. In a scenario where a server is located in a remote branch office or a high-density rack where physical access is difficult, the lack of remote control capabilities becomes a significant logistical burden.
